An excellent production starring Whoopi Goldberg as a musical star who has to go into hiding after witnessing a crime... and hides in a convent. Maggie Smith is a wonderful Mother Superior, and the film is a testament to good music, people who care for each other, and a fight against crime and mobs.

Set in the United States, with great timing, and some humour as well as a bit of violence (mostly off screen). Rated PG but unlikely to be of interest to children.
